Method
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the noodles according to package directions.
- While the noodles cook, mince the garlic, grate the fresh ginger, and slice the green onions.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, sesame oil, brown sugar, rice vinegar, and red pepper flakes to make the sauce.
- Heat a large skillet over medium heat and add the Italian sausage. Cook, breaking it into small crumbles, until browned and fully cooked.
- Add the garlic and ginger to the skillet and cook for about 1 minute, until fragrant.
- Pour the sesame sauce into the skillet and stir gently to coat the sausage.
- Add the drained noodles to the skillet and toss until every strand is coated in the sauce.
- Sprinkle with sesame seeds and sliced green onions. Taste and adjust with more soy sauce if needed, then serve warm.
Notes
Use pre-minced garlic and ginger to save time, or swap in pre-cooked sausage for an even faster version. You can also add shredded carrots, snap peas, or cabbage for extra texture and color.
